Created by Gabriel da Silva Coelho
over 8 years ago
|
||
Question | Answer |
Static tipo nome; Qual a função do Static aqui? | Criar uma variável de Classe,não precisando criar uma instância para usar a variável. |
Static void chutar(); Qual a função do Static aqui? | Criar um utilitário da Classe,não precisar instanciar um objeto par usar o método. |
Public Class Carro { Public Static Olho { } }; Qual a função do Static aqui? | Criar uma Classe Interna estática. |
public final class Cachorro Qual a função do Final aqui? | Criar uma classe que não pode ser herdada/estendida. |
final ChessPlayer getFirstPlayer() {} Qual a função do Final aqui? | Garantir que esse método não seja sobrescrito em nas subclasses |
final int x = 1; Qual a função do Final aqui? | garantir a imutabilidade de variável,fazendo que seja atribuída um valor uma única vez! |
Private Class Cavalo{}; Qual a função do Private? | Limitar a visibilidade,só classes no mesmo arquivo fonte podem ver. |
Um arquivo .Java pode ter quantas classes? | 1 publica e varias privates. o arquivo ,Java leva o nome da Publica. |
Public void metodo(); Qual a visibilidade? | Todas Classes enxergam desde que se enxergue a classe também. |
Private void método() Qual a visibilidade? | Somente classes no mesmo aquivo fonte enxergam. |
Protected void metodo() Qual a visibilidade? | Pode ser visto por classes do mesmo pacote ou subclasses |
Por que Pacotes? | Para organizar as diversas Classes. |
Qual a ideia de Interface? | Criar um contrato onde uma ou mais classes precise assinar alguma funcionalidade especifica. |
O que uma interface pode conter? | Pode conter: Constantes e assinaturas de métodos. |
Want to create your own Flashcards for free with GoConqr? Learn more.